WebFeb 16, 2006 · If a Shakespearean play ends in marriage, it’s a comedy, and if it ends in death, it’s a tragedy. But what if a Shakespeare play acts like a tragedy up until the very end, where the play suddenly ends in marriage? That is referred to as the Problem Play — for which “Measure for Measure” qualifies, due to its ambiguous tragic-comedy status, …

It is also assumed that Shakespeare played many roles in a variety of his own plays, including Macbeth (King Duncan), As You Like It (Adam), Henry IV (King Henry), and Hamlet (the Ghost of Hamlet's father).

Only eighteen of Shakespeare’s plays were published separately in quarto editions during his lifetime; a complete collection of his works did not appear until the publication of the First Folio in 1623, several years after his death.
